What is Imali?
Imali is a WhatsApp business OS for South Africa's informal merchants. It handles bookkeeping, invoices, inventory and SARS tax prep through a WhatsApp message, in English, isiZulu and isiXhosa — no app to download.
How much does Imali cost?
There is a free plan (R0), a Starter plan at R29/month, and a Premium plan at R99/month.
Which countries and currencies does Imali support?
Imali ships as a South Africa, rand-only product. The platform handles 21 currencies under the hood (SADC-ready, with daily ECB rates), but it is not a multi-country product today.
Is Imali available now?
Yes — it's a live pilot, onboarding merchants across Gauteng and the Western Cape since April 2026. The company is raising pre-seed.
Does Imali give out loans?
Not yet. Imali is designed to turn cash businesses into creditworthy ones, and the credit-signal layer is built, but no loan has been originated and no lender is signed.
